Intelligence agencies advise government employees to remove TikTok from work phones

The Minister points out that it is possible that TikTok will provide data to the Chinese government. In China, there is a law that can oblige companies to cooperate with the government. That law must be nuanced, say privacy experts. TikTok could still refuse this.

To this day, the company also emphasizes that it has never cooperated with their government, and never will. The company has already admitted that Chinese employees have had access to data from European users in the past. This led to a tightening of their privacy policy.
